Abstract

The invention discloses an electric fan capable of generating power. Fan blades are connected with a fan blade motor through a fan blade shaft. A motor shell is arranged outside the fan motor. A rear grid is arranged at the rear end of the motor shell. A front grid is fixed to the front portion of the rear grid. A stand column is connected to the lower portion of the motor shell. The lower end of the stand column is connected with a base. A generator is arranged in the motor shell. Small fan blades are arranged in the air outlet direction of the fan blades. The generator is connected with the small fan blades through a small fan blade shaft. A storage battery is connected to the output end of the generator. An electrical control board is further arranged. The electrical control board is connected with the fan blade motor, the generator and the storage battery. The electric fan capable of generating power has the advantages that the purpose of energy saving is achieved by collecting and utilizing wind energy generated by the electric fan, power supply is achieved through switching between the mains supply and the storage battery, and the electric fan can be used in the case of emergency when accidental power failure occurs; a big fan body drives a small fan body to rotate, so that two kinds of air flow are generated at the same time by the inner-circle fan blades and the outer-circle fan blades, after the two kinds of air flow are fully mixed on the front portion of the fan, even air flow is blown out, and therefore the comfort of wind is improved.

Embodiment
By describing technology contents of the present invention, structure characteristics in detail, being realized object and effect, below in conjunction with mode of execution and coordinate accompanying drawing to be explained in detail.
See also Fig. 1 to Fig. 3, a kind of electric fan generating electricity of present embodiment, comprise fan blade 5, blade motor 9, motor casing 11, front grid 6, rear grid 7, column 12 and base 15, described fan blade 5 is connected with described blade motor 9 by blade shaft 8, the outer motor casing 11 that is provided with of described blade motor 9, the front end of described motor casing 11 is provided with described rear grid 7, be fixed with described front grid 6 in the front portion of rear grid 7, the below of described motor casing 11 connects described column 12, the lower end of described column 12 connects described base 15, in described motor casing 11, be provided with generator 10, the air-out direction of described fan blade 5 is provided with little fan blade 1, described generator 10 is connected with described little fan blade 1 by little blade shaft 2, the output terminal of this generator 10 is connected with storage battery 14, also be provided with electric-controlled plate 13, this electric-controlled plate 13 is connected with described blade motor 9, generator 10 and storage battery 14, can adopt the modes such as remote control, line traffic control, button, knob to operate electric-controlled plate 13.
Preferably, described generator 10 is located at the rear of described blade motor 9, described blade shaft 8 is quill shaft, its head and the tail two ends are respectively equipped with bearing 4, described bearing 4 is in-built described little blade shaft 2, little fan blade 1 is stretched out to connect in one end of described little blade shaft 2 from the center of described fan blade 5, the rotor of the other end of little blade shaft 2 and generator 10 is fixed together; Described storage battery 14 is located in described base 15, in described column 12, is provided with electric-controlled plate 13; Also be provided with LED lamp 3, described LED lamp 3 is located on described front grid 6 and with described electric-controlled plate 13 and is connected, and in having a power failure, the electric energy that can store using storage battery 14 by the control of electric-controlled plate 13 is powered and used as emergency lighting to LED lamp 3.
The present invention in use, controls blade motor 9 by electric-controlled plate 13 and turns round, and the blade face of the little fan blade 1 of gas shock that fan blade 5 produces makes its also rotation together, and then drives generator 10 produce electric energy and be stored in storage battery 14; Electric-controlled plate 13 is also with charge and discharge protecting module and electrical source exchange module; in the time that the interior charge capacity of storage battery 14 reaches certain value; cut off city's electric contact 16 and transfer home loop to by electrical source exchange module and power to blade motor 9 or LED lamp 3 with storage battery 14; when charge capacity is during lower than certain value, then switchback mains-supplied pattern.
